As the founder and principal of Clint Nicholas Design, Clint Nicholas guides the design and realization of bespoke homes for his discerning clientele. Nicholas grew up with a deep appreciation for nature and craft. His latent talent bloomed on moving to Los Angeles, where he apprenticed with visionaries in interior design and architecture: Sandy Gallin, Scott Mitchell, and Michael Lee. While collaborating with them on the décor of luxury residences, he developed his philosophy that alluring home design is not only about creating a look, but about making a welcoming space for living and entertaining through a careful layering of sensory materials and well-chosen artifacts and personal pieces. Drawing inspiration from art, travel, and architectural history, his work balances timeless restraint with expressive, livable warmth.

Nicholas has been described as an “ambience producer,” and takes a hands-on, relationship-based approach to all his projects, based on close listening and understanding how the homeowner wants to live. Attention to detail and service are paramount for Nicholas and the team that he leads.
